Output 68295da597534dfd530106b82edea11d8f4e44d82bd8329ade3872034ac1cbc3:1
- value
- 51341149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b61f380a1f9efdab3d9873ad0a8ea38ddf3d78c OP_EQUAL
- address
- 34BoWVQZtDf5kpoAk1X4YC61D1u5SpPJca
- transaction
- 68295da597534dfd530106b82edea11d8f4e44d82bd8329ade3872034ac1cbc3
- confirmations
- 223266
- spent
- true